What is Live Scan Technology?
Live Scan is a big improvement over the old way of taking fingerprints. The old way is used ink and paper. Live Scan uses an electronic process to take pictures of fingerprints, making it more accurate and less likely to have mistakes.
In California, Live Scan means fingerprints are scanned with a special machine and sent directly to the California Department of Justice to check backgrounds. This way is faster and more reliable, which is important for the justice system.
How Live Scan Helps the Justice System
Live Scan makes it easier and faster to find out who suspects and lawbreakers are. This means there are fewer mistakes compared to doing it by hand. The technology makes checking criminal records more accurate and quicker, which is important since decisions often need to be made quickly.
Live Scan isn’t just for finding suspects. It’s also used for checking backgrounds when hiring people, especially for jobs in law enforcement, healthcare, and schools, where a clean record is very important.

Live Scan and Public Safety
Live Scan is important for keeping public safety by stopping people with criminal records from getting jobs in sensitive areas. This is very important for keeping trust in teachers and healthcare workers.
The technology also helps keep track of sex offenders and checks their compliance, making sure people who could be dangerous are watched.
